Greek mythology is a rich collection of stories, legends, and beliefs passed down through generations about gods, goddesses, heroes, and monsters of ancient Greece. These myths explain the origins of the world, natural phenomena, and human society, and have profoundly influenced Western culture and art.

In Greek mythology, the winged horse Pegasus is most famously ridden by the hero Bellerophon. Bellerophon, with the help of Athena and her magical bridle, tamed Pegasus and used him in several heroic deeds, most notably to defeat the monstrous Chimera. However, Bellerophon's attempt to fly to Mount Olympus on Pegasus angered Zeus, who punished him by causing Pegasus to throw him, leading to Bellerophon's downfall.
